About half of business owners want to transfer their business to a child but only 30% do so. Families are not without their conflicts, especially in family businesses. By having annual family meetings to discuss the possible succession plans for the company, you will be more prepared for an exit.
Managing a Family Owned Business involves navigating business decisions as well as family relationships. Without a detailed succession plan, you are setting your daughter up to fail in a business that has not maximized its value prior to transition. Without having tough conversations about the future of their business, family business owners will fail to have a succession plan in place.
33% of those surveyed received their business from family and 6% purchased the business from their family. Even if the child can afford to purchase the business outright, are they qualified to run the business? 95% of children who inherit a family business after both their parents pass will choose to leave the advisor who worked with their parents.

If you are eager to secure the 9.62% annual interest for Series I bonds the deadline is Friday, October 28th. The rate is expected to drop to 6.48%. A few quick facts about I Bonds:
--> I Bond rates change twice yearly based on inflation
--> Your money is locked up for 12 months and you cannot take it out for any reason
--> Each individual may purchase up to $10,000 worth of series I bonds in a year (plus up to $5,000 if you are owed a tax refund)
